My iswara have the same prob to.Put dos silicon spray also cannot.Open the door cover and check,found out that the x rail that gets ur window up and down already reach its age.the window 10s to move left&right.There is a screw to adjust at the right side of the door connected to the rails.Try to adjust that first for temp use.its advised to change the tingiii.
